Jihan Intan Prananingrum is a robotics researcher whose work focuses on advancing autonomous mobile systems, particularly through holonomic control and omnidirectional locomotion. Her most-cited paper, "Holonomic Implementation of Three Wheels Omnidirectional Mobile Robot using DC Motors" (2020, 44 citations), addresses a critical challenge in competitive robotics: enabling robots to efficiently chase and capture a ball in dynamic environments like the Indonesian Wheeled Football Robot Contest (KRSBI). By applying holonomic methods to omnidirectional movement, she demonstrated how three-wheeled platforms can achieve precise, multi-directional navigation using cost-effective DC motors—a contribution that bridges theoretical control systems with practical, real-world robotics. This work has been influential among researchers and students developing agile robots for sports and autonomous tasks.
